California couple pays $1 million restitution for 2006 wildfire

Posted on Categories Uncategorized

Jonathan and Penny Bourne have paid $1 million to the federal government for causing a fire in 2006 that burned about 7,435 acres of the Inyo National Forest. The Sawmill fire started after the Bournes burned brush in a pit. The fire was not completely extinguished and winds blew embers into nearby vegetation.
